Based on a survey by Statista, 131.43 million Americans used power toothbrushes in 2020. But, are electric toothbrushes actually better? Do they actually clean your teeth better than a manual toothbrush? While American Dental Association (ADA) says both manual and electric toothbrushes can be effective at keeping your teeth clean—powered brushes have some advantages.
In a study by Cochrane with 5000+ participants, comparing the effectiveness of both brush types, “an 11% reduction in plaque at one to three months of use, and a 21% reduction in plaque when assessed after three months of use” was found when using an electric toothbrush. That’s a huge reduction! Similarly, with gingivitis, the study boasts “a 6% reduction at one to three months of use and an 11% reduction when assessed after three months of use.”

Plaque Removal
As mentioned, electric toothbrushes shine in their ability to move very, very fast. According to a 2015 consumer report, electric toothbrushes remove 21% more plaque than manual brushes due to their oscillating bristles.
This built-in rotation, or vibration, and added dexterity help clean your teeth faster, and more effectively. Make your teeth and your dentist happier by switching out your manual brush for an electric one!
Increased Focus while Brushing
Let’s be honest, brushing your teeth is boring. But brushing with an electric toothbrush can be a LOT more enjoyable. In a recent study, dentists observed 14 people brushing with a standard or an electric toothbrush. They found that “users of the electric toothbrush appeared to brush in a more concentrated and focused tooth brushing pattern vs. the manual brush.”
The participants also felt an improvement in the cleaning efficacy, paired with a better overall brushing experience. We can’t blame them—brushing with a power toothbrush DOES feel better.

Less Plastic Waste
If plastic waste isn’t on your mind, it should be! It’s a major issue to our environment, and the rate at which the world is producing waste is just not sustainable. According to National Geographic, if you took every toothbrush tossed away in the U.S. alone each year, laid them out in a line, they would wrap completely around the Earth four times!
Since the majority of toothbrushes are not recyclable, you can help reduce your toothbrush waste over time by switching to an electric one. Rather than tossing out a full toothbrush each time you switch to a new brush, you’ll only have the brush head to replace. Of course, your best option for a zero-waste toothbrush is bamboo, but electric comes in 2nd as a wonderful compromise that’s simply better for the environment than a standard plastic toothbrush (and better at cleaning your teeth, too).

Sonic Technology
What is sonic technology? It’s sound waves that are used to move around particles in a medium—such as the bristles on a toothbrush head. It’s beneficial in teeth cleaning because the bristles are able to move side-to-side really, extremely fast.
